Fighting the Drugs War: The role of prohibitionist groups in Australian illicit drugs policy

The title of this post is also a seminar coming up in Melbourne at Turning Point:

“Prohibitionist lobby groups appear to be exerting an increasing influence on Australian illicit drugs policy. Yet remarkably little is known about their history, membership, sources of funding, political and ideological agenda, and employment of empirical evidence. Dr Mendes will discuss the key activities and objectives of these groups, drawing some conclusions about their current and likely future influence on national drugs policy.
